Ingredients
1 store-bought flatbread or naan (or homemade)
1 cup fresh cherries, pitted and halved
1 tbsp olive oil
1 tsp balsamic vinegar
1/2 cup crumbled goat cheese
1/4 cup ricotta cheese (optional for creaminess)
1 tsp honey
Fresh thyme or basil leaves
Salt and black pepper to taste
Balsamic glaze for drizzling
Instructions
1.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
2. Toss cherries with olive oil, balsamic vinegar, salt, and pepper. Roast for 10–12 minutes until juicy and slightly caramelized.
3. Place the flatbread on the baking sheet and spread ricotta (if using) evenly on top.
4. Top with roasted cherries and crumbled goat cheese.
5. Bake for 8–10 minutes, or until the edges are golden and cheese is lightly melted.
6. Drizzle with honey and balsamic glaze.
7. Sprinkle fresh thyme or basil leaves before serving.
8. Slice and enjoy warm or at room temperature.
Notes
Use a mix of sweet and tart cherries for a flavor balance.
Try blue cheese instead of goat cheese for a bolder twist.
Add prosciutto or arugula for a gourmet touch.
Makes an amazing appetizer, light dinner, or brunch addition.
